Rip Current Risk Category

* Low Risk - The risk for rip currents is low, however,

life-threatening rip currents often occur in the vicinity of groins,

jetties, reefs, and piers.

* Moderate Risk - Life-threatening rip currents are possible in the

surf zone.

* High Risk - Life-threatening rip currents are likely in the surf

zone.
